All That I See

All that I see BW

How quick I am to judge, to impose my needs and perspective on others.
I see what I label as short-comings, inadequacies, and things I want to change in them.
Oh, life is such a magnificent mirror.
When I look to change others, I am seeing in that mirror all that I wish to change in me.
But I forget that what I see is simply a reflection.
Perhaps instead of looking at what needs to change, I can see all the beauty that lies within them and in me, all the gifts, all the talents, all the goodness, just as they are.
If all I see in that mirror is the goodness, then that is all that there will be.

There’s No Time In the Present

Time

Time is fleeting, but only if you are looking forward or backward.

If you are truly present, then time is invariable. In the moment, time stands still.

If you want more time to do the things you love, then do the things you love.

Time does not fill spaces, spaces are filled with time.

Live your life fully present and you will find time.
